Abstract

This paper gives a brief review of the main environmental and ecological problems of slimes dams, both those created in the immediate vicinity of the dams and those influencing the region or catchment. Methods of dealing with these problems and influences on existing dams are described. The difficulties encountered in the growing of grass on steep slopes are explained, and, after an analysis of the conditions, a plea is made for flatter slopes on the sides of dams.
